What is the longest trail in North Carolina?

the North Carolina Mountains to Sea Trail
North Carolina’s longest trail, the North Carolina Mountains to Sea Trail, is an ambitious project to provide a foot path linking the Mountains in the West to the Coastal Plain in the East. The trail, when completed, will be over 900 miles in length.

What are the big 3 hiking trails?

The Triple Crown of Hiking Award is a distinction bestowed to hikers who have walked the Appalachian Trail, Pacific Crest Trail, and Continental Divide Trail in their entirety.

Can you hike Grandfather Mountain for free?

HIKING IS FREE ON GRANDFATHER STATE PARK TRAILS The back country of Grandfather Mountain is now Grandfather Mountain State Park. There is no charge to access Grandfather Mountain State Park from trail heads outside the travel attraction, but registration is required for safety reasons.

Which is harder Appalachian Trail or PCT?

You’ll want to note that the AT takes five to seven months to complete its 2,190 miles, while the PCT take four to six months to complete 2,650 miles of trail. That shows, when evaluating the most obvious factor, terrain, the AT is without question the more difficult of the two trails.

How long does it take to hike Looking Glass Rock?

4-5 hours
The Looking Glass Rock Trail climbs about 1,700 ft. in just over three miles (6.5 miles round-trip, allow 4-5 hours). The many switchbacks along the way help make for a long and moderately difficult climb. A strong hiker can make it to the top in 1.5 hours and down in one hour.

Can you camp anywhere on Appalachian Trail?

Dispersed camping is allowed on roughly half of the Trail, with the largest area of land open to dispersed camping concentrated on U.S. Forest Service lands; specific guidance may differ in each forest. No dispersed camping is allowed on the A.T. in the states of Maryland, Connecticut, and Massachusetts.

Mingo Falls means “Big Bear” in Cherokee and stands at 120 feet tall. To reach it, you need to climb 160 stairs and half a mile on the Pigeon Creek Trail.

How many miles of hiking trails are in Hickory NC?

The 189-acre park in Hickory is a woodland paradise and hosts six miles of scenic hiking trails. The trails here are all pretty well-connected but the Orange (0.5 miles) and Blue (1.2 miles) are the two that’ll take you to the highest peak.
